The Technology Behind AI Hair Health Diagnostics
1. Multispectral Scalp Imaging
Captures images under different light wavelengths to assess hydration, inflammation, and follicle density.
2. Deep Neural Analysis
Trained on millions of scalp images, AI models can differentiate between healthy, oily, dry, or sensitive scalp types with over 95% accuracy.
3. Trichological Data Fusion
Combines imaging with bio-sensor readings such as temperature, pH, and microcirculation for comprehensive health insights.
4. Predictive Damage Modeling
AI forecasts potential hair loss or scalp irritation based on environmental exposure, genetics, and styling frequency.
5. Adaptive Treatment Algorithms
Platforms like HairSmart Analyzer auto-adjust recommendations based on user behavior, environmental changes, and seasonal shifts.

Ethical and Wellness Considerations
1. Privacy of Biological Data
All scalp imagery and analysis must be stored locally or securely encrypted to prevent sensitive health data leaks.
2. Dermatological Validation
AI systems must align with trichology and dermatology standards to ensure safe and accurate diagnostics.
3. Bias in Data Training
Hair density and texture vary globally; inclusive datasets ensure accuracy across all ethnicities and hair types.
4. Sustainable Intelligence
AI must optimize product usage to minimize waste — turning technology into a driver for responsible consumption.

Step-by-Step: How Smart Scalp Analysis Works
| Step | Process | Function |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Capture scalp image via smart camera or brush | Gathers texture and follicle data |
| 2 | AI segmentation and analysis | Identifies scalp zones and problem areas |
| 3 | Match against global trichology database | Benchmarks results against millions of samples |
| 4 | Generate insights and treatment plan | Suggests product, diet, and lifestyle actions |
| 5 | Continuous learning | Adapts with every scan for improving accuracy |
